The Rise of "Leave on Read" in Digital Communication

The advent of instant messaging platforms like WhatsApp, Telegram, and Facebook Messenger has fundamentally altered the landscape of interpersonal communication. These platforms allow for real-time conversations, blurring the lines between physical and virtual interactions. However, this very immediacy has also created a new set of social norms and expectations. "Leave on read," the act of acknowledging a message by viewing it but not responding, has become a prevalent practice in digital communication. This seemingly simple act can be interpreted in various ways, ranging from a subtle form of social rejection to a deliberate attempt to avoid engagement.

The Socio-Cultural Context of "Leave on Read"

The interpretation of "leave on read" is deeply intertwined with the socio-cultural context in which it occurs. In a society where instant gratification is the norm, the act of leaving a message unread can be perceived as a deliberate act of disrespect or indifference. This is particularly true in close relationships, where a prompt response is often expected. However, the meaning of "leave on read" can also vary depending on the nature of the relationship, the content of the message, and the individual's communication style.

The Psychological Impact of "Leave on Read"

The act of being "left on read" can have a significant psychological impact on the recipient. It can trigger feelings of rejection, insecurity, and even anger. This is because the act of leaving a message unread can be interpreted as a deliberate attempt to ignore or dismiss the sender. In some cases, it can even lead to feelings of anxiety and self-doubt, as the recipient may begin to question the strength of the relationship or their own worthiness.

The Social Implications of "Leave on Read"

The prevalence of "leave on read" in digital communication has also had a significant impact on social dynamics. It has created a new set of social norms and expectations, where the speed of response is often seen as a measure of social engagement. This can lead to a sense of pressure to respond quickly, even if the individual is not available or does not have a response ready. It can also create a sense of anxiety and insecurity, as individuals may feel the need to constantly monitor their digital presence and respond to messages promptly.
